About The company:
NoBrokerHood started in the year 2018, aimed to make life more convenient and secure for residents in any
housing society. NoBrokerHood offers a plethora of services and features which enables its customer, as a user, to
manage multiple activities inside residential buildings, housing societies, and gated communities. From finding
domestic help to monitoring visitor entry and maintenance or utility bill payment, it’s all done from your phone. It
also further strengthens the safety of your society by keeping visual and digital records of all entries and exits –
accessible anytime and anywhere – and automates staff entry through a facial recognition or biometric process.
